Job Description

Overview

Weyerhaeuser is seeking an Electrical & Instrumentation Supervisor for its Timberstrand manufacturing plant in Brampton, Ontario. In this role, you will oversee the daily activities of a team focused on safety, quality, and maintenance, ensuring that production goals are met in a 24/7 operational environment. The position emphasizes team leadership, effective communication, and proactive problem-solving to sustain operational efficiency.

Key responsibilities

  • Plan and lead daily activities of Electricians and Process Control Technicians.
  • Ensure safety of all associates and contractors by addressing safety issues.
  • Participate in planning and scheduling of electrical work to minimize impact on production.
  • Utilize troubleshooting methods to maximize uptime and achieve production goals.
  • Manage maintenance requests and inventory using computer-based programs.
  • Provide effective leadership and support to the Electrical team.
  • Facilitate effective communication across shifts and with production teams.

Required skills

  • Minimum 3 years' supervisory experience in an industrial environment.
  • Excellent communication skills (interpersonal, written, verbal, electronic).
  • Trades certification or Post-secondary diploma in technology or engineering.
  • Proven analytical tro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
  • Experience with CMMS (SAP) and process control (PLC) preferred.
  • Solid computer skills in Microsoft Office, including Microsoft Project.

What the company offers

  • Eligible for annual merit-increase program.
  • Salary range of $95,560 - $139,470 based on skills and experience.
  • Annual Incentive Program with cash bonus targeting 10% of base pay.
  • Comprehensive employee benefits plan including medical, dental, and vision.
  • Defined Contribution Pension Plan with company match up to 6%.
  • Support for personal volunteerism and mentoring opportunities.
